| Genetic information | Mutant mice have a curly tail. |
| Phenotypic information | Curly tail in heterozygous (?) animals. |
| Breeding history | Original background: satin (Foxq1sa) on C3H/HeH partial congenic. Crossed to C3H/HeH for several generations. |
